F22B DOHC head + F23 bottom end possible?
Moved from the All Motor forum, seemed better here.
Got a 92 Accord LX w/ a F22b DOHC in trade for a 90 Integra with a crappy body but good engine. I call it good. Accord is in decent shape, except for the ricer cf over metal fenders and altezza crap which will be gone soon.
Previous owner ran the F22B DOHC without checking the oil at any point. Well, it leaked all out and seized up, went BOOM. Now there is a hole in the block behind the A/C bracket the size of my fist. Poor car.
I've read the F22b/f22a hybrid threads on CB7tuner etc., but not finding a good answer. Is the F23 block physically the same as far as oil passage dimensions, feed ends, etc as the F22 block? The F22B had all the correct F22B intake mani, JDM ECU, 99 JDM Prelude auto w/ LSD, etc. as far as I know. It ran like a scalded dog, I'd like to make it do such again.
So is the F22B head onto an F23a bottom any different than F22B head onto a original to the car F22a bottom end? Is there anything I need to plug up / reshape etc?

It is basically the same. It worked well for me: 200whp 183wtq.
In my signature: https://honda-tech.com/zerothread?id=1495684
The F22B DOHC chamber is larger than the F23's so the compression will drop a bit.
